Manx Gas works beginning tomorrow
A main route into and out of Douglas closes this evening, ahead of the start of a major scheme tomorrow.
Manx Gas is replacing its mains pipes on Bucks Road, between the Rosemount and the junction with Circular Road.
The three-phase project is scheduled to take 11 weeks in its entirety.
Manx Gas's customer network services director, Robert Gardner, says it's essential work which has been planned for a long time - adding that diversions, closures and traffic lights will be in place.
The first section of Bucks Road to shut is between the Rosemount and the junction with Demesne Road, from 7pm.
That's due to be closed for three weeks.
